Rohit Sharma tore into Mayank Yadav by launching consecutive deliveries into the stands during the ongoing clash between Mumbai Indians and Lucknow Super Giants at the Wankhede Stadium on Sunday, April 27. The two maximums came after the first delivery was a bumper drifting down leg side which the ace batter was unable to connect.

The first shot was more of a swivel by Rohit, as he guided the 141 kph delivery over the long leg fence. Mayank persisted with a similar channel and copped similar fate as the former MI skipper brought out the classical pull to dispatch the ball for a 77-metre maximum over deep square leg.

Mayank, who was playing his first game of IPL 2025, had the last laugh though. The speedster's slower ball produced the wicket of the dangerous-looking Rohit. Rohit was aiming to steer the slower delivery towards the off side. However, all he could manage was skewing the ball to the fielder at short third man. The opening batter had to walk back for 12 off five.

With this, Rohit became only the third opener in IPL history to slam two sixes of his first two balls in an IPL innings. The elusive feat has been achieved only by his compatriots Virat Kohli and Yashasvi Jaiswal prevuously. 


Openers to hit two sixes off their first two balls in an IPL innings 

  • Virat Kohli vs RR, Bengaluru, 2019
  • Yashasvi Jaiswal vs KKR, Kolkata, 2023
  • Rohit Sharma vs LSG, Mumbai, 2025

Earlier in the afternoon, the visitors won the toss and sent MI in with the bat. The joint-most successful franchise made a couple of changes to their XI. Karn Sharma and Corbin Bosch came in for Mitchell Santner and Vignesh Puthur. As for LSG, Mayank came in for Shardul Thakur.

LSG got the better of MI when the sides had met in Lucknow earlier in the season. The hosts claimed victory by 12 runs in a game where MI failed to track down the 204-run target. Digvesh Rathi was awared the Player of the Match accolade for his miserly four-over spell of 1/21. Interestingly, Rohit did not feature in this game.
